Mangarli - Tumsar, Bhandara
Mangarli is a village situated in the Tumsar tehsil of Bhandara district, Maharashtra. It is located approximately 38 km from the tehsil headquarters in Tumsar and around 58 km from the district headquarters in Bhandara. Lendezari serves as the Gram Panchayat for Mangarli village.
As per Census 2011, the village code of Mangarli is 536679. The village covers a total geographical area of 164 hectares and falls under the 441912 pincode. Tumsar is the nearest town, located about 38 km away.
Mangarli village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head.
Population of Mangarli
As per Census 2011, Mangarli village has a total population of 409 people, consisting of 203 males and 206 females. The village has 92 households and a sex ratio of 1,014 females per 1,000 males. There are 53 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 279 literate and 130 illiterate residents. Additionally, 60 people belong to Scheduled Caste (SC) communities and 3 to Scheduled Tribe (ST) communities.
Detailed gender-wise population figures for Mangarli are given below:
| Category | Total | Male | Female |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total Population | 409 | 203 | 206 |
|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 53 | 27 | 26 |
| Scheduled Castes (SC) | 60 | 29 | 31 |
| Scheduled Tribes (ST) | 3 | 1 | 2 |
| Literate Population | 279 | 147 | 132 |
| Illiterate Population | 130 | 56 | 74 |

Transport and Connectivity of Mangarli
Mangarli is connected by an all-weather road, and public transport is mainly available through bus services.
| Connectivity |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Public Bus Service | Yes | Available within village |
| Private Bus Service | No | Available within >10 km |
| Railway Station | No | - |
In addition to basic transport facilities, distances and travel times help define overall connectivity. The road distance from Tumsar to Mangarli is about 38 km, with a usual travel time of around 1-1.25 hours. Similarly, the road distance from Bhandara to Mangarli is about 58 km, with the usual travel time around ~1.7 hours. Actual travel time may vary depending on road conditions and mode of transport.
Banking and Postal Services in Mangarli
Banking and postal services are essential for daily financial transactions and communication. The availability of these facilities for Mangarli village is detailed below:
| Service Type |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Bank | No | Available within >10 km |
| ATM | No | Available within >10 km |
| Post Office | No | Available within >10 km |
Health Facilities in Mangarli
Healthcare facilities play an important role in providing basic medical services to the residents. The details regarding the nearest health centres and hospitals serving Mangarli village are given below:
| Facility Type |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Health Sub-Centre (HSC) | No | Available within 5-10 km |
| Primary Health Centre (PHC) | No | Available within 5-10 km |
| Community Health Centre (CHC) | No | Available within 5-10 km |
